John Piper Explores the Ultimate Source and Object of Pleasure, Satisfaction, and Lasting Joy
"God is most glorified in us when we are most satisfied in him." This simple but powerful statement has been a cornerstone of John Piper's ministry for nearly 40 years. Laying out the principles behind this "Christian Hedonism" Desiring God has proved to be a source of rich theological insight for countless readers through the years, guiding them to the fullness of joy found in Christ.
In this foundational work, John Piper addresses profound questions about the purpose of life and the human pursuit of pleasure. Drawing wisdom from Scripture and insights from church history, Piper challenges the belief that believers must sacrifice joy in order to please God. Instead, finding delight in God does not diminish his glory; rather, it magnifies it and fulfills the deepest desires of our souls.

Über den Autor / die Autorin










John Piper is founder and lead teacher of desiringGod.org and chancellor of Bethlehem College & Seminary. He served for thirty-three years as a pastor at Bethlehem Baptist Church in Minneapolis, Minnesota, and is the author of more than fifty books, including Desiring God; Don't Waste Your Life; and Providence.
